Re: Norton DNS black hole - Redirecting websites to Edgekey.net

Hi,

 

Thanks for the updates.  It's not an attack :-).  It was caused by some false positives on websites.  After we received the reports, the team worked on the issue immediately and corrected the issue as soon as we could.
